1. Connection through USB-cable: step-by-step instruction
The most reliable and quickest way is to use the cable, but even here there are nuances: you need to choose the right mode of connection and adjust the permissions on your smartphone.
Follow the algorithm:
- Connect the cable to your phone and PC. Use the USB 3.0 port on your computer for maximum speed.
- Xiaomi will have a notification on the screen, "USB for file transfer."
- Select a mode: π File transfer (MTP) β Accessing the phone memory as a flash drive. π· Transmission of photographs (PTP) β If you only need to download a photo/video. π Charging - data transfer is disabled. π§ Midic or USB-modem for special tasks (not suitable for files).

Important for Windows: If the phone is defined as βUnidentified Device,β open Device Manager β find the device with the yellow exclamation mark β update the driver manually by specifying the folder with the downloaded Xiaomi drivers.
2. setup debugging over USB (for advanced users)
If the standard connection doesnβt work or you need advanced features (for example, for firmware via Fastboot), turn on USB debugging. This mode allows you to access the system functions of the phone from your PC.
How to turn on:
- Go to Settings. β The phone.
- Tap 7 times on the MIUI version until the notification βYou are a developer!β appears.
- Back to Settings β Additionally. β For developers.
- Activate the "Debugging by USB" switch.
- Connect the phone to the PC and confirm the debugging permission on the smartphone screen.
Now you can use tools like ADB (Android Debug Bridge) to manage files through the command line, such as copying a file from a PC to a phone:

β οΈ Attention: Debugging by USB It gives PC programs full access to your phone's data. Don't connect your device to other people's computers with debugging enabled, which is a risk of personal information leaking or malware installation.
3. File transfer over Wi-Fi (without cable)
If you don't have a cable on hand or want to transfer files remotely, use wireless methods. They're slower than USB, but they're convenient for periodic data exchange.
Method 1: FTP-server
- π± Install from Google Play app FX File Explorer or Solid Explorer.
- π In the application settings, find the section "FTP-server and activate it.
- π Remember the address of the species ftp://192.168.x.x:xxxx.
- π» On the PC, open "Conductor" β enter the address in the address bar β Enter the login / password (specified in the appendix).
Method 2: Mi Drop (Official Solution from Xiaomi)
- π² Install Mi Drop on your phone from the Mi App Store.
- π₯οΈ Download the desktop version of Mi Drop from the official website.
- π Scan it. QR-PC screen code or log in to one Mi Account on both devices.
- π Drag files between devices in the program interface.

4.The solution to the problems: PC doesn't see Xiaomi
If the phone is not detected in any of the modes, check the following points:
- π Cable or port: Try another cable (preferably original) and port USB Ports on the front of the system unit are often weaker in power.
- π§ Drivers: Remove current Xiaomi drivers through Device Manager β "Remove the device and restart the PCs. The system will install them again.
- π± Phone Settings: Go to Settings β Connections β USB And reset the default settings.
- π‘οΈ Antivirus: Temporarily disable antivirus (such as Avast or Kaspersky) β they can block the connection.
For Windows 10/11, there is a universal solution:
- Open the control panel. β Devices and printers.
- Find your Xiaomi in the list (may appear as "MI" or "Android").
- Right-click. β "Troubleshooting".
β οΈ Note: On some models POCO (for example, POCO X3 Pro) The default mode is "Charge Only" when you connect to your PC. To change it, pull the notification curtain down and select MTP manually.
5. Alternative methods: cloud services and third-party programs
If none of the above methods are suitable, use cloud services or specialized software:
- βοΈ Google Drive / Mi Cloud: Upload files to the cloud from your phone, then download them to your PC. Suitable for large volumes (up to 15 GB free on Google Drive).
- π₯οΈ AirDroid: Remote phone management from a PC that allows you to transfer files, view notifications and even respond to a phone. SMS.
- π Pushbullet: Syncs files between devices via Google account. handy for fast link sending or small files.
There is a caveat for macOS: the system does not always work correctly with MTP.
- Install Android File Transfer (official software from Google).
- Connect the phone in MTP mode.
- Start the program β it should automatically detect the device.

6. Security in data transmission
Transferring files between devices is a potential privacy risk.
- π Turn off the debugging. USB After use, especially if you connect your phone to other people's computers.
- π« Do not use public Wi-Fi to transfer files through the Internet. FTP Mi Drop β data can be intercepted.
- π‘οΈ Encrypt sensitive files before transfer (e.g., a password archive).
- π Check your files with antivirus after downloading them to your PC, especially if they come from unreliable sources.
If you often transfer files between Xiaomi and your PC, consider encrypted cloud storage (such as Cryptomator + Google Drive).
